Korn Ferry (NYSE:KFY – Get Free Report) insider Michael Distefano sold 5,000 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Monday, September 23rd. The shares were sold at an average price of $72.36, for a total value of $361,800.00. Following the transaction, the insider now owns 50,954 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$3,687,031.44.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website.

Korn Ferry (NYSE:KFY –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, September 5th. The business services provider reported $1.18 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.12 by $0.06. Korn Ferry had a net margin of 6.68% and a return on equity of 13.73%. The company had revenue of $682.80 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$663.84 million.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.99 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 3.3% on a year-over-year basis.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Korn Ferry will post 4.84 earnings per share for the current year.

About Korn Ferry
Korn Ferry, together with its subsidiaries, provides organizational consulting services worldwide. It operates through four segments: Consulting, Digital, Executive Search, and Recruitment Process Outsourcing (RPO) & Professional Search. The company provides executive search services to recruit board level, chief executive, other senior executive, and general management talent of organizations.
